The Scientific Objectives
TAKE 2017 will have the following objectives:
a) To analyze the relation between the theory and the applications the economy of the 21st century.
b) To understand how to improve the management of the knowledge based economy we live in.
c) To analyze the today's economy putting together contributions for various fields, namely Knowledge Management, Intellectual Capital, Human Resource Development, etc.
d) To deal with specific problems we felt are decisive in the economy as Competitiveness, Innovation and Entrepreneurship;
e) To analyze specific sectors that are at the heart of the economic live like the Public Sector, and Logistics,
f) To analyze the case of specific countries, and not only in the developed OECD countries but also in the BRICs.
We consider the knowledge economy a broad spectrum which includes things such as diverse as: HRD, KM, IC, etc, as described by the 10 standing streams and therefore we welcome really contributions in all these fields.
The Team
For this conference we have gathered together a team of 17 scholars from 11 countries (Austria, Canada, Croatia, Finland, Germany, Liechtenstein, Portugal, Romania, South Africa, Spain, and USA), that will assure the development of 12 streams, in different areas of the topic Theory and Applications in the Knowledge Economy.
And it will be organized in collaboration of University of Zagreb, Faculty of Economics and Business (Croatia); GOVCOPP, Universidade de Aveiro (Portugal) and E4 Conferences Scientific Organization.
TAKE 2017 will also co-managed by GOVCOPP the research centre on Public Policies classified with Excellent by the Portuguese Foundation for Science and Technology in 2015.
TAKE 2017 will be also managed by E4 Conferences Scientific Organization a company specialized in organizing international conferences.
The Programme Commitee
The Programme Commitee consists of the conference keynote speakers and stream leaders. The stream leader(s) are responsible for organizing and managing the blind peer-review process within the particular conference stream. The conference papers are peer-reviewed by at least two independent reviewers. The Programme Commitee is responsible to maintain high ethical standards regarding the peer-review process.


Video: Sydney Harbour Knowledge Cafe



On 25th October 2007 I ran a Knowledge Cafe in Sydney. It was hosted by Annalie Killian of AMP on the 25th Floor of their building overlooking Sydney Harbour.

The Cafe was on the theme "What will be the impact of Social Tools within Organizations?" which I co-facilitated with Helen Paige who is regional director of the Gurteen Knowledge Community in Adelaide. About 70 people attended. It was a great evening.

The Gurteen Knowledge Community
The Gurteen Knowledge Community is a global learning community of over 21,000 people in 160 countries across the world.

The community is for people who are committed to making a difference: people who wish to share and learn from each other and who strive to see the world differently, think differently and act differently.

Membership of the Gurteen Knowledge Community is free.
